			<title>Anonymize Google Chrome</title>
			<link>http://feedproxy.google.com/~r/improvedmind/~3/Q8ext8hP98g/58-anonymize-google-chrome</link>
			<guid isPermaLink="false">http://www.improvedmind.com/software/tools/58-anonymize-google-chrome</guid>
			<description><![CDATA[The new Google browser Chrome identifies every user by assigning a unique id to every installation. If you want to anonymize your Windows version of Chrome do the following:<br /><ul><li>Open this file: "D:\Documents and Settings\\Local Settings\Application Data\Google\Chrome\User Data\Local State"</li><li>for these entries change the values to "0": client_key, wrapped_key, client_id, client_id_timestamp</li></ul><br />it should look like this:<br /><br />Â Â  "safe_browsing": {<br />Â Â Â Â Â  "client_key": "0",<br />Â Â Â Â Â  "wrapped_key": "0"<br />Â Â  },<br /><br />further down:<br /><br />Â Â  "user_experience_metrics": {<br />Â Â Â Â Â  "client_id": "0",<br />Â Â Â Â Â  "client_id_timestamp": "0",<p>&nbsp;</p><p>Hint: There is a tool called UnChrome, which sets user_experience_metrics to 0, but leaves safe_browsing as it is. I do not recommend using this tool. If you want a tool, you might want to try <a href="http://www.opwoco.com/silentio/" target="_blank">silentio</a>.</p>]]></description>

			<title>Solution for installing DOCman v1.40RC3 on Joomla 1.5</title>
			<link>http://feedproxy.google.com/~r/improvedmind/~3/ZNGNad9cNr0/55-solution-for-installing-docman-on-joomla-15</link>
			<guid isPermaLink="false">http://www.improvedmind.com/internet/joomla/55-solution-for-installing-docman-on-joomla-15</guid>
			<description><![CDATA[<p><img src="http://www.improvedmind.com/images/stories/2008/dm_logo_small.png" border="0" alt="DOCman" title="DOCman" align="right" />If you have trouble installing the document management and download component DOCman on Joomla 1.5, this solution might help. It seems that DOCman does not work with PHP 4. It always gives you an installation error saying: Unwriteable &lt;joomla root&gt;/</p><p>So here is what you can do about it. If you run your installation on a shared server try to enable PHP 5 with the help of your .htaccess file. Some hostersallow this by adding the following line:</p><p>AddHandler php5-cgi .php</p><p>After adding this line to your .htaccess file you can have a look at your Joomla backend "Help - System" and see if the PHPversion changed. If everything went well, you can install now DOCman 1.40 without any problems. </p><p>PS: If you need to remove the double entriesin the DOCman backend that were created by the erroreous installations, you need to go to the Modules Manager - Administrator. You will find them there.</p>]]></description>

			<title>Multi site FTP update tool</title>
			<link>http://feedproxy.google.com/~r/improvedmind/~3/wKb427kYY2I/53-multi-site-ftp-update-tool</link>
			<guid isPermaLink="false">http://www.improvedmind.com/software/tools/53-multi-site-ftp-update-tool</guid>
			<description><![CDATA[<p>Do you have more than one website to take care of? Are you running Wordpress, Joomla, Drupal, or any other blog / content management system? Then you might know this problem: How to update multiple sites at once when an update of your blog or cms software comes out?<br />If you just have your ftp client you will probably log in to every ftp server and transfer the files to each of your sites. Now let's assume you have like ten or twenty sites, this can take quite some time. I had this problem before, so I decided to look for an automated way to update multiple websites with just one click.</p><p>These tools can make your life much easier when you need to update multiple ftp sites at once:</p><h2>Wordpress FTP Update Tool</h2><p>This is a very handy tool for uploading a set of files to multiple FTP sites. It was made for Wordpress updates, but it can actually be used for all multi site transfers. So you can use it for updating your favorite content management system, like Joomla, Drupal or whatever...Â  <br />It works for Windows XP/Vista.</p><p>Download: <a href="http://www.seo-vault.de/wordpress-ftp-update-tool/" target="_blank" title="Multiple FTP Site Transfer Tool">http://www.seo-vault.de/wordpress-ftp-update-tool/ </a></p><p><img src="http://www.improvedmind.com/images/stories/articles/wpupdate.png" border="0" alt="Multiple FTP Site Upload Tool" title="WP Update Screenshot" /> </p><h2>Â </h2><h2>WS_FTP</h2><p>With the help of its scripting opportunities, you can automate your file upload to multiple sites.<br />It works for Windows XP/Vista. </p><p>Download: <a href="http://www.ipswitch.com/" target="_blank" title="WS_FTP">http://www.ipswitch.com/</a> </p><p>&nbsp;</p><h2>RSync</h2><p>RSync is a syncronization tool for Linux, once configured it can upload your files to as much sites as you want. One feature is that it just replaces newer files, so non changed filesÂ  will not be re-uploaded again.</p><p>Download: <a href="http://rsync.samba.org/" title="RSync">http://rsync.samba.org/</a> </p><p>&nbsp;</p><h2>GAdmin RSync </h2><p>Based on RSync this tool for linux gives you a nice graphical user interface for your multi site transfer.</p><p>Download: <a href="http://85.214.17.244/gadmintools/index.php?option=com_content&task=view&id=51&Itemid=38" title="Gadmin -RSync">http://85.214.17.244/gadmintools/</a></p>]]></description>

			<title>Total Commander - the best filemanager for Windows</title>
			<link>http://feedproxy.google.com/~r/improvedmind/~3/hgj-lSEUois/54-total-commander-best-filemanager-for-windows</link>
			<guid isPermaLink="false">http://www.improvedmind.com/software/tools/54-total-commander-best-filemanager-for-windows</guid>
			<description><![CDATA[<p>When I started using computers, it has been the time of MS DOS 5.0. It was the time when programs were started by using the command line and not by clicking icons. And there was this tool called Norton Commander, which gave you a graphical user interface (GUI). It made your life much easier by being able to manage your files in completely new way.</p><div style="text-align: center"><img src="http://www.improvedmind.com/images/stories/articles/norton_commander.jpg" border="0" alt="Norton Commander" title="Norton Commander" /><br />Screenshot: Norton Commander<br /></div><p>&nbsp;</p><p>When Windows was becoming the new standard operating system, a new tool was taking over the place of Norton Commander. This tool was called Windows Commander. After some trouble with Microsoft they had to rename it to "Total Commander". And that's still its name. But from the old times of a simple file management tool, Total Commander has become the all-in-one-super-tool in todays Windows world.</p><div style="text-align: center"><img src="http://www.improvedmind.com/images/stories/articles/total_commander.jpg" border="0" alt="Total Commander" title="Total Commander" /><br />Screenshot: Total Commander<br /></div><p>&nbsp;</p><p>Just some of the features</p><ul><li><font face="arial" size="2">Two file windows side by side</font></li><li><font face="arial" size="2">Built-in FTP client with FXP (server to server) and HTTP proxy support</font></li><li><font face="arial" size="2">Multi-rename tool</font></li><li><font face="arial" size="2">Tabbed interface, regular expressions, history+favorites buttons</font></li><li><font face="arial" size="2">Multiple language support</font></li><li><font face="arial" size="2">Enhanced Search Function - Search for files and within files</font></li><li><font face="arial" size="2">Compare files (now with editor) / synchronize directories</font></li><li><font face="arial" size="2">ZIP, ARJ, LZH, RAR, UC2, TAR, GZ, CAB, ACE archive handling + plugins</font></li><li><font face="arial" size="2">Thumbnails view, custom columns, enhanced search</font></li></ul><p>I really want to emphasize that it is the best tool available in my opinion and probably the one that you really should consider buying. It's definitely worth it!</p><p>Download: <a href="http://www.ghisler.com/" target="_blank" title="Total Commander">http://www.ghisler.com/ </a></p>]]></description>
